Anyhow, back to my ATC. I used one of the lovely Healing Heart girls and prettied up her dress with gold trim and gem buttons and gave her tights some added detail with a black fine-liner pen. I gave her a snail from Snail's Pace and a bird from Lovely Garden. I coloured the digi stamps with Copics and added white Posca pen highlights. Also, you'll notice the extra specks of stray ink that always find their way onto my finished ATCs - I really don't know how I do that!!


The background is a gelli print made with Distress Oxides - I added a white die cut border at the base, topped with some gold glitter tape and some fine gold trim. A piece of gold ric-rac trim was placed along the right hand side. The sentiment was made using the new Baby Powder font from Vera Lane Studio - I printed it out in Bold, cut it into strips and inked the edges with Faded Jeans. It was glued directly onto the background. The girl, bird and snail were popped on foam tape for some dimension.
Finally the edge of the ATC was inked first with Faded Jeans and then with Black Ranger Archival ink.
